Practical Information

Duration:

4 semester


Modes:

  • First semester from September till January: special integration semester.
    • Specific technical courses with some common courses with French engineering students.
    • Intensive French language courses.
  • Next three semesters: standard master engineering curriculum.

Teaching Language:

Courses are fully conducted in English.


Master Degree obtained

After successful completion of the program: the graduate will be awarded the engineering master degree (“Diplôme d’ingénieur”).


Degree Awarded:

This degree is recognized by the French government, accredited by the Engineering Accreditation Institution CTI and recognized as an international Master degree within the European Bologna scheme

Need to know

Tuition fees

  • 10 514€ per year (for AY)
  • Fees do not include health insurance, accommodation and living expenses.
  • Admitted applicants must make a deposit of 50% of annual tuition fees before August 1st to confirm their enrollment.

How to apply

  • To apply to Isep and join an engineering program starting in September, submit your application online by July 15.
  • Follow the application steps by preparing the necessary documents, such as a passport photo, a copy of your passport, your CV, and a statement of purpose.
  • The selection process includes a review of your application and an interview.

About ISEP

  • Founded in 1955 as part of the Catholic University of Paris; over 70 years of history with roots in the discovery of the coherer by Édouard Branly.
  • It's a Grande École in digital engineering, accredited by CTI and a member of the Conférence des Grandes Écoles, with non‑profit EESPIG status.

Locations & Campuses

  • Paris (Notre‑Dame‑des‑Champs) – in the 6th arrondissement, close to Montparnasse and Luxembourg Gardens.
  • Issy‑les‑Moulineaux (Notre‑Dame‑de‑Lorette) – opened in 2014, near major tech companies like Microsoft and Orange.
  • New Bordeaux campus launching in the 2025 academic year.

Academic Programs

  • Integrated Engineering Cycle: a 2-year prep phase after high school, then 3 years in the Engineering Degree. Includes options for apprenticeship.
  • International Engineering Master’s Program (IEMDP): 2-year master’s pathway for those with bachelor’s degrees.
  • Specializations: Embedded Systems, Software, Wireless/IoT, Cybersecurity, Data Intelligence, and more.

Teaching & Student Experience

  • Emphasis on project‑based learning, small-group instruction, and strong industry partnerships that shape curriculum, internships, and apprenticeships.
  • Full internship participation: 4–6 months mid-cycle plus 5+ months at the end.
  • Rich international environment: partnerships with ~160 universities worldwide, including an exclusive Stanford-Paris collaboration; every student has international experience.

Career Outcomes

  • Appears consistently in top rankings for digital engineering; in 2019, ranked #1 in France for IT graduates' salaries.
  • Near-100% graduate employment rate, with strong average salaries (~€45 k/year) .

Campus Life & Community

  • Over 30 student clubs and associations, including award-winning Junior ISEP.
  • Values of Listening, Excellence, and Commitment shape its inclusive, ethically driven curriculum
